Description Here's the first comic for chapter 3 of FE: Dawn of Darkness!

There was some suspense in the last comic, now there's a little humor in this one. Haha.

Anyway, after arriving in another mountain town, Ranulf and Elincia tease Ike a little because he seems to have a hard head, yet anyone that knows him well knows that he's a pretty open-minded guy. Ike isn't amused though, lol.

Also, the incident Ike is talking about here is from a short story I wrote called Ashes of War. It's found on my fanfiction.net account.

Oh, and since there's a bunch of comics in this series so far, I'm going to put up a chronological index so everyone knows which comic happens when. There will probably be times that I make them out of order for various reasons (such as a lack of the correct mugshots or battle sprites).
